Alexander von Nordmann: A Pioneering Biologist of the 19th Century

A Legacy in Zoology, Parasitology, and Botany

Alexander von Nordmann was a Finnish biologist who made significant contributions to the fields of zoology, parasitology, and botany in the 19th century. He is best known for his groundbreaking research on parasitic worms and crustaceans, which led to a greater understanding of their life cycles and habitats.

Early Life and Education

Born on May 24, 1803, in Ruotsinsalmi, Vyborg Governorate (now part of Russia), Nordmann was the son of a Russian army officer. He began his academic pursuits at the Imperial Academy of Turku, where he also served as a curator of the entomological collections. In 1827, he continued his studies in Berlin under the guidance of renowned parasitologist and anatomist Karl Rudolphi.

Major Works and Discoveries

Nordmann's most notable work was his microscopical description of tens of parasitic worms and crustaceans found in the eyes and other organs of fishes and other animals, including humans. This research led to the discovery of the enigmatic monogenean Diplozoon paradoxum. His work was published in two volumes, Mikrographische Beiträge zur Naturgeschichte der wirbellosen Thiere I & II, in 1832.

Teaching and Expeditions

In 1832, Nordmann became a professor and teacher at the Lyceum Richelieu in Odessa, Kherson Governorate. Two years later, he was appointed director of the Odessa Botanical Garden and the associated Central Gardening School. During his time in Odessa, he participated in several expeditions, collecting numerous natural history specimens in southern Russia and adjacent regions.

Late Life and Legacy

In 1849, Nordmann returned to Finland and became a professor of Zoology and Botany at the Imperial Alexander University in Helsinki. He continued to work tirelessly, publishing several papers and contributing to various scientific expeditions until his death on June 25, 1866.

Taxonomic Legacy

Nordmann's contributions to science have been recognized through the naming of several species and a genus in his honor. The cladoceran Evadne nordmanni, the Nordmann fir Abies nordmanniana, and at least seven other species bear his name. The standard author abbreviation "Nordm." is used to cite his work in botanical nomenclature.
